Kodak Acid Violet 19 Developer Dye

A measured portion pack of Acid Violet 19 dye used in black and white photographic film developers to enhance contrast and tone. Classified under HTS 3707.90.31.00 as an unmixed chemical preparation for photographic uses, specifically Acid Violet 19, put up for retail sale ready for use in darkroom processing.

Alternative Classifications

This product could be classified differently depending on its characteristics or intended use.

3204.12.50Higher: 41.5% vs 35%

If sold as a general synthetic dye not specified for photography

Acid Violet 19 as a basic dye falls under Chapter 32 if not prepared or packaged specifically for photographic applications.

3707.90.60Same rate: 35%

If imported in bulk for industrial repackaging

Unmixed products not put up in measured portions or for retail sale are classified separately in the same heading.

3822Lower: 10% vs 35%

If part of a mixed laboratory reagent kit

Diagnostic or laboratory reagents containing Acid Violet 19 would shift to Chapter 38 as composite preparations.

Import Tips & Compliance

• Verify purity and concentration matches Acid Violet 19 specifications to avoid reclassification under general dyes (Chapter 32)

• Include Safety Data Sheets (SDS) and photographic end-use certification in documentation for customs clearance
